你查询的IP:[116.70.49.31]  地理位置:中国–北京–北京

最新查询117.40.94.120 118.84.157.222 118.80.144.88 60.63.91.229 161.207.240.181 221.136.219.248 119.163.251.208 222.32.112.196 122.242.64.171 116.70.49.31 203.209.224.93 221.198.223.119 116.69.114.141 116.1.199.157 125.32.232.250 218.56.84.102 119.80.137.94 121.55.72.59 124.20.160.71 203.99.16.231 220.231.212.111 222.192.211.229 124.42.61.85 202.127.216.15 121.56.79.177 210.51.29.0 203.89.79.19 58.99.128.117 125.216.112.148 116.215.156.33 203.187.160.116